Don't worry Lasse, that is why we are having some fun races in these cars. We need to get used to them, they are very different to the other GPL cars. They are not nimble like the F1 cars, you have to drive them a bit slower. I always feel like I'm crawling into the corners only to find I'm going too fast and I run wide.

I also had a first tonight. I think that was the fastest I've ever been in a GPL car. On the last lap I got a perfect tow from Fulvio and my speedo was showing 228mph (367 km/h) when I pulled out to overtake. But I wasn't gentle enough on the steering wheel and I got into a tank-slapper which caused a massive crash, sorry Fulvio. I've never experienced that before. Not sure if I can dial that out of my set-up but I suspect it was quite realistic and just a consequence of my bad driving.

. . . . the 66 race was a disaster for me cos I was thumped off the track approaching Mulsanne Corner - need to look at what happened.
I must own up to being the thumper.  These cars do not like direction changes under hard braking, so a lane change entering the braking zone is hazardous.  I had warmed my tyres, but should have applied more straight line caution.  Braking distances vary. Undecided
